Developing a Strategic Mindset

No matter if you manage a group or are the head of a company, having a strategic mind is key to your success. Strategic thinkers are open and willing to listen to new ideas. They are able balance today’s needs with tomorrow’s goals. Tactical thinkers on the other hand are more process-driven and cost-focused, and prefer clear briefs. In addition, they are less flexible and are more likely to follow procedure and avoid risk. Qualities that make strategic thinkers great

Strategic thinkers can see the bigger picture, and have a vision of the future. They aren’t afraid to challenge the status quo and believe that asking the right query is as important as getting the right answer. They are able to change direction as necessary and constantly revise their assumptions in light of new information. Strategic thinkers can also make sense overarching trends by analysing information from multiple angles.

Next, strategic thinkers must be able to question everything. Although this does not mean that one should reject a brilliant idea, it does suggest that one should carefully consider the facts. A big asset is to keep an open mind and be willing to learn from others. They are curious about the world around them and open to new ideas. They are willing to take risks, embrace failure and have the ability to ask questions to gain an advantage.

Ways to develop a strategic mindset

Are you looking to achieve more success in your business? Are you interested in developing a strategic mindset? If so you aren’t alone. Many people strive to become better strategic thinkers, and more business-savvy. Developing your strategic thinking skills will help you think of things in terms of the big picture. Your ability to think strategically will enable you to envision different outcomes. This will make planning and execution of your goals easier. The key to a strategic mindset is practice and patience.

Strategic thinking can be aided by learning from your past mistakes. Take the lessons from past failures and use them to improve your future thinking. If you still have trouble understanding the strategic thinking process, it is worth sharing your experiences with friends and colleagues. Ask your friends and colleagues what do you think they have learned and how they have improved their strategies. If you find that you are still struggling, take some time off from your routine tasks. You can improve your strategic thinking skills by taking a break from the daily grind.

Develop a strategic mindset for others

Developing a strategic mindset in others begins with understanding what it takes to develop one. These people are highly curious and savvy about their businesses. They are open to learning and challenging their own ideas. Knowledge of business metrics is crucial to a strategic mindset. They must also understand how these affect the entire business. Knowledge of the details is also necessary, but only if a person understands how those details contribute to the overall strategy.

People with a strategic outlook are better equipped to identify threats and recognize opportunities before they cause actual damage. This mindset encourages people to challenge assumptions and seek out new opportunities. A strategic mindset helps people think more strategically and act faster, which can be the difference between a successful business and a failing one. This mindset can be learned by encouraging collaboration and challenging work practices.
